Genetic polymorphisms of IL-6-174 and IL-10-1082 in full term neonates with late onset blood stream infections
Journal of Pediatric Infectious Diseases, 10/15/09
Abdel–Hady H et al. – The IL–6 –174 CC and IL–10 –1082 GG genotypes were associated with increased risk for mortality, need for inotropic support and development of disseminated intravascular coagulopathy in full–term neonates with BSIs. These findings suggest that the genetic composition of the IL–6 and IL–10 promoter areas play a significant role in the pathogenesis of neonatal BSIs.
